2011-10-05 157 views
0

昨天一切正常,但今天早上XCode一旦我打开我的项目就会崩溃。Xcode每当我打开我的项目时立即崩溃

有什么建议?


的崩溃对话框说

内部错误

Xcode中遇到一个内部逻辑错误。选择“继续”至 继续以不一致的状态运行Xcode。选择“崩溃”至 暂停Xcode并提交Crash Reporter的错误。选择“崩溃” 会导致所有未保存的数据丢失。

,如果我点击“显示详细信息”下面的信息显示

断言失败在 /SourceCache/IDEFoundation/IDEFoundation-287/Framework/Classes/Model/SourceControl/IDESourceControlTree.m :2548 细节:(addedItem)不应该是零。对象:
方法:
-mergeStatusOperationResults:forLocalStatusOnly:主题:{名称=(空),NUM = 11}提示:无回溯:0 0x0000000100949773 - [IDEAssertionHandler handleFailureInMethod:对象:文件名:LINENUMBER:MessageFormat中:参数: ] (在IDEKit)1 0x000000010006d394 _DVTAssertionFailureHandler(在 DVTFoundation)2 0x000000010055e1c1 __78- [IDESourceControlWorkingTree mergeStatusOperationResults:forLocalStatusOnly:] _ block_invoke_0(在 IDEFoundation)3 0x0000000100005fdc __38- [DVTDispatchLock performLockedBlock:] _ block_invoke_0(在DVTFoundation)4 0x00007fff87886fbb dispatch_barr ier_sync_f(在libSystem.B.dylib)5 0x0000000100005f83 - [DVTDispatchLock performLockedBlock:](在 DVTFoundation)6 0x000000010055ccd3 - [IDESourceControlWorkingTree mergeStatusOperationResults:forLocalStatusOnly:](在IDEFoundation)
7 0x00000001005db64c __77- [IDESourceControlWorkingTree updateLocalStatusForDirectory:completionBlock :] _ block_invoke_01137(在 IDEFoundation)8 0x00007fff8788dd64 _dispatch_call_block_and_release(在libSystem.B.dylib)9 0x00007fff8786c8d2 _dispatch_queue_drain(在libSystem.B.dylib)10 0x00007fff8786c734 _dispatch_queue_invoke(在libSystem.B.dylib)11 0x00007fff8786c2de _dispatch_worker_thread2(在libSystem.B.dyli B)12 0x00007fff8786bc08 _pthread_wqthread(在libSystem.B.dylib)13 0x00007fff8786baa5 start_wqthread(在libSystem.B.dylib)

回答

1

你可能对这个项目的源代码库的重复条目。去组织者下并删除重复,看看是否解决了这个问题。不幸的是,XCode 4中的SCM工具仍然存在很多错误。

+0

+1,是的,我有多个条目,现在我除去了一个,但Xcode仍然崩溃。也许我可以从我的电脑中删除一切,然后再次从颠覆中下载它? – ragnarius

+0

有一种方法可以解决这个问题 - 我想。它涉及到删除XCode已经建立的SVN缓存 - 但我似乎无法找到我在遇到此问题时使用的文章。重新安装XCode可能会/可能无法真正解决问题。 – dtuckernet

相关问题